fomüllerde hata

dilekgüç

Altın Üye
Katılım
23 Mart 2005
Mesajlar
156
Excel Vers. ve Dili
Acemi
Altın Üyelik Bitiş Tarihi
30-09-2025
FORMÜLLERDE HATA VERİYOR DOSYANIN İÇİNDE TAM AÇIKLAMASI VAR
İYİ RAMAZANLAR
 

Necdet

Moderatör
Yönetici
Katılım
4 Haziran 2005
Mesajlar
15,367
Excel Vers. ve Dili
Ofis 365 Türkçe
Sayın dilekgüç, Makrolardan anlamıyorum ama örneği incelediğimde boş olan değerler üzerinde işlem yapıyorsunuz, sanırım o yüzden hata veriyor. Bunu kontrol etmek gerek
 

dilekgüç

Altın Üye
Katılım
23 Mart 2005
Mesajlar
156
Excel Vers. ve Dili
Acemi
Altın Üyelik Bitiş Tarihi
30-09-2025
Necdet_Yesertener,
boş olan değerler üzerinde işlem yapıyorsunuz???
SATIR KOMPLE FORMÜLÜ NOT BÃ?LÜMÜNDE ACIKLAMA YAPTIM
İYİ CALIÞMALAR
 

mehmett

Altın Üye
Katılım
18 Mayıs 2005
Mesajlar
2,571
Excel Vers. ve Dili
Excel 2010 Türkçe
Sayın @dilekgüç

Dosyanızdaki 0*0 sonucunu veren formüllerden dolayı hata veriyor. Bunu önlemek için Ehatalıysa fonksiyonunu kullanmanız gerekir.

Diyelim ki bir hücrede =N5*K1 formülü var. Eğer N5 ve K1 hücrelerinde sıfırdan farklı değerler varsa bu formül sorunsuz çalışır. Fakat N1 ve K1 hücrelerinden biri veya her ikisi de sıfır ise formül sonucu 0*sayı veya 0*0 olur ki bu da #Değer hatası verir.

Yukarıda verdiğim =N5*K1 formülü, Ehatalıysa fonksiyonu ile şu şekilde yazılır.

=EÐER((EHATALIYSA(N5*K1));"";(N5*K1))

Bunun anlamı şudur;

"Aslında benim formülüm =N5*K1'dir. Ama bazen bu iki hücreden biri veya her ikisi de sıfır olabilir. Bu durumda formül hata verebilir. Formül sonucu Hata verirse formülü görmezden gel ve hücreye "" değeri gir, yani hücreyi boş bırak. Hata yoksa N5*K1 formülünü yürüt."

Dosyanızda birkaç hücredeki formüllerinizi Ehatalıysa fonksiyonu ile birleştirerek ve dikkatinizi çekmesi için dolgu rengini turuncu yaparak ekte gönderiyorum. Eğer işinizi görecekse diğer hücrelere de siz uygularsınız.

Kolay gelsin.
 

dilekgüç

Altın Üye
Katılım
23 Mart 2005
Mesajlar
156
Excel Vers. ve Dili
Acemi
Altın Üyelik Bitiş Tarihi
30-09-2025
zerige
ARKADASIMA ÇOK TESEKKÜRLER ACEMİ EXCEL KULLAMANLAR USTALARIN BASINI BİRAZ AGRITIYIRUZ
 

mehmett

Altın Üye
Katılım
18 Mayıs 2005
Mesajlar
2,571
Excel Vers. ve Dili
Excel 2010 Türkçe
Rica ederim Dilek hanım, başımı ağrıtmanız söz konusu değil. "Usta" sıfatını da üzerime alınmıyorum. Hem ben kolay sorulara cevap vererek, başta Levent bey olmak üzere zor sorulara cevap yetiştirebilmek için yoğun bir şekilde çalışan birkaç kişinin yüklerini elimden geldiğince hafifletmeye çalışıyorum. Kolay sorularla zaman kaybetmesinler diye. :)
 
Üst